Welcome to 7 Thomson Road, Simcoe, a beautifully maintained brick 2 storey home offering approximately 2,700 sq. ft. of finished living space in one of Simcoe’s desirable neighbourhoods. Lovingly cared for, updated, & meticulously maintained by the current owners for over 40 years, this exceptional property offers the perfect combination of comfort & quality craftsmanship. Surrounded by mature trees, impeccable gardens & beautiful landscaping, this home provides a peaceful setting. Step inside to discover a bright welcoming living room with gleaming hardwood floors. The spacious updated kitchen features granite countertops, built in appliances, ample cabinetry, and a functional layout that seamlessly connects to the formal dining room, creating the perfect space for family gatherings & entertaining. A second main floor living area offers a gas fireplace & sliding doors with California shutters leading to your private backyard oasis, complete with a large inground swimming pool with solar heating, ideal for enjoying warm summer days with family & friends. The second floor features 4 generous bedrooms, including a primary bedroom with a private 3 pc ensuite, along with an updated 4 piece main bathroom with jacuzzi tub. The finished lower level adds even more versatile living space with a large recreation room, additional room currently used as a bedroom, spacious utility with laundry area & wine cellar. Practical features include 2 pc bath on the main, direct access to the double car garage, plus a unique storage area just inside the back entrance with roughed in plumbing, offering the opportunity to create a pool change room. Recent major updates include a furnace & A/C in 2018 and shingles in 2020.
